Resume/Bio:
Karin A. Costa began her career in antiques and collectibles in the 1980's with her own antiques brokerage company in suburban Chicago. She quickly became the "go-to" valuer for family estates eventually opening an estate sale business.
A graduate of the Missouri Auction School and its Certified Appraisers Guild of America, Karin has been an auctioneer and appraiser for prominent western Washington, northern California and Nevada estates and special collections, including antiques, fine art, coins, jewelry, workshop, farm and commercial assets for over 25 years.
Karin is a generalist appraiser holding the Master Personal Property Appraiser designation from the NAA, Registered Gemologist Appraiser designation from the International School of Gemology, AIA-PACC credential from the Asheford Institute of Antiques, and Certified Appraiser designation from the Certified Appraisers Guild of America. She successfully completed the Certified Machinery and Equipment Appraiser credential from the NEBB Institute.
Karin focuses in the field of estate and family law. She is a qualified appraiser for IRS estate, gift and charitable contribution appraisals. She also prepares USPAP compliant appraisals for divorce, family and partnership equitable division, and guardianship and probate inventories. She works with collectors of fine and decorative art, antique furniture and jewelry as a collection manager preparing and organizing collection databases.
In addition, Karin is an appraisal report reviewer helping clients in litigation, mediation and other disputes establish the accuracy, consistency and logic of another appraiser's appraisal or appraisal review, with or without a value conclusion.
She loves the hunt for treasures and enjoys sharing with clients the history and market insights of hidden "gems". A consummate student, Karin includes ongoing study in the fields of antiques, fine art, jewelry and machinery (the hard and soft assets classes) and engages with specialists when necessary to discuss an asset and its market.
